Navigation
API > API/Runtime > API/Runtime/Engine
References
| Module | Engine |
| Header | /Engine/Source/Runtime/Engine/Public/MaterialShared.h |
| Include | #include "MaterialShared.h" |
Syntax
class FMaterialTextureParameterInfo
Variables
| Type | Name | Description | |
|---|---|---|---|
| FHashedMaterialParameterInfo | ParameterInfo | ||
| TEnumAsByte< ESamplerSourceMode > | SamplerSource | ||
| int32 | TextureIndex | ||
| uint8 | VirtualTextureLayerIndex |
Functions
| Type | Name | Description | |
|---|---|---|---|
| void | GetGameThreadTextureValue
(
const UMaterialInterface* MaterialInterface, |
||
| void | GetGameThreadTextureValue
(
const UMaterialInterface* MaterialInterface, |
||
| FName | |||
| const FTypeLayoutDesc & | |||
| FTypeLayoutDesc & |
Classes
| Type | Name | Description | |
|---|---|---|---|
| InternalLinkType | |||
| InternalLinkType< COUNTER-CounterBase > |
Typedefs
| Name | Description |
|---|---|
| DerivedType | |
| InternalBaseType |
Constants
| Name | Description |
|---|---|
| CounterBase | |
| InterfaceType |